BP_GET_COMPRESS
int cpfunc = BP_GET_COMPRESS(bp);
enum_lookup("enum zio_compress", BP_GET_COMPRESS(bp),
comp = BP_GET_COMPRESS(bp);
comp = BP_GET_COMPRESS(bp);
BP_GET_COMPRESS(bp));
BP_IS_PROTECTED(bp), BP_GET_COMPRESS(bp), type,
if (BP_GET_COMPRESS(bp) == ZIO_COMPRESS_OFF)
compress = BP_GET_COMPRESS(bp);
if (BP_GET_COMPRESS(bp) != ZIO_COMPRESS_OFF) {
VERIFY0(zio_decompress_data_buf(BP_GET_COMPRESS(bp),
DDK_SET_COMPRESS(ddk, BP_GET_COMPRESS(bp));
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
ASSERT3U(BP_GET_COMPRESS(bp), !=, ZIO_COMPRESS_OFF);
drrw->drr_compressiontype = BP_GET_COMPRESS(bp);
DDK_SET_COMPRESS(&drrw->drr_key, BP_GET_COMPRESS(bp));
drrw->drr_compression = BP_GET_COMPRESS(bp);
drrs->drr_compressiontype = BP_GET_COMPRESS(bp);
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
if ((BP_GET_COMPRESS(bp) >= ZIO_COMPRESS_LEGACY_FUNCTIONS &&
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
compress = zio_compress_table[BP_GET_COMPRESS(bp)].ci_name;
ASSERT(BP_GET_COMPRESS(zio->io_bp) == ZIO_COMPRESS_OFF);
ASSERT(BP_GET_COMPRESS(zio->io_bp) == ZIO_COMPRESS_OFF);
if (BP_GET_COMPRESS(bp) != ZIO_COMPRESS_OFF &&
BP_GET_COMPRESS(bp) != BP_GET_COMPRESS(bp_orig) ||
int ret = zio_decompress_data(BP_GET_COMPRESS(zio->io_bp),
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
ASSERT3U(BP_GET_COMPRESS(bp), ==, ZIO_COMPRESS_OFF);
if (BP_GET_COMPRESS(bp) != ZIO_COMPRESS_OFF) {
ret = zio_decompress_data(BP_GET_COMPRESS(bp),
if (BP_GET_COMPRESS(bp) >= ZIO_COMPRESS_FUNCTIONS ||
BP_GET_COMPRESS(bp) <= ZIO_COMPRESS_ON) {
bp, (longlong_t)BP_GET_COMPRESS(bp));